What makes sewage water removal different from regular water extraction?

Sewage water is classified as blackwater, which means it carries dangerous pathogens. We use specialized protective equipment that is unnecessary for category 1 water. Our waste handling also differ significantly because sewage cannot be dumped in standard drains.

Can sewage damage my home’s foundation or structural elements?

Absolutely, and timing is so critical. Raw sewage contains acids and chemicals that compromise structural integrity. The longer sewage sits against support beams causes structural weakening. We have seen support beams rot in Washington properties where sewage sat for days before extraction. Getting the sewage out fast protects your structure from this type of damage.

What should I do while waiting for your sewage removal team to arrive in Liberty Lake, WA?

Take precautions right away. Avoid areas with standing sewage. Turn off electricity to affected areas if you can do so safely from outside the area. Open windows for ventilation if possible. Avoid touching contaminated water – you could get infected. Restrict access to contaminated areas. Will my homeowners insurance cover sewage water removal costs?

Insurance coverage varies significantly based on the source of contamination. Many policies cover sewage backups when you purchased backup coverage. Standard policies often exclude sewer backup if you did not request it. We advise checking your policy immediately after scheduling removal. What happens if sewage has soaked into my walls or flooring?

Structural elements soaked with blackwater usually require replacement. Carpeting that absorbs contaminated water becomes permanently contaminated. Our service extracts the water, but rebuilding demands restoration companies to remove contaminated materials. We can identify which areas absorbed contamination during our assessment in 99019.
